I learned a valuable lesson last night about clutter. It comes back if you arn't careful. Our dining room was cleaned and gorgeous. A few days later the lovely dining room setting was ruined by a heap of clutter accumulating on the dining room table. Before I went to bed last night I removed all the clutter from the dining room table, reset the candles, and made it look like before, perfect. i went to bed and woke up, walked into the clean neat and tidy dining room and heaved a sigh of relief to view the sight of cleanliness and order, versus the huge pile of mail and crap that was there last night. So NIP IT IN THE BUD when it starts going to seed again! It will. So, be prepared
